#452010 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#452010 is composed of 27.1% red, 12.5%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.6% magenta, 76.8% yellow and 72.9% black. It has a hue angle of 18.1 degrees, a saturation of 62.4% and a lightness of 16.7%. #452010 color hex could be obtained by blending #8a4020 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

● #452010 color description : Very dark orange [Brown tone].
#452010 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#452010 has RGB values of R:69, G:32,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.54, Y:0.77,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 4530192.

Shades and Tints of #452010
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050201 is the darkest color, while #fdf7f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#452010
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2b2a2a is the less saturated color, while #521b03 is the most saturated one.
